Carlsberg A/S Class B (CABJF) currently reports a intangible assets of $24B as of December 2025. That compares with $11B in the prior-year period — up 121.5% year over year. Use the charts on this page to explore Carlsberg A/S Class B's intangible assets history and peer comparisons.
